What does an NBA President do?

The NBA President is a high-ranking executive responsible for overseeing the operations and strategic direction of the National Basketball Association. This role typically involves managing league policies, collaborating with team owners, handling labor relations, and promoting the growth of basketball both domestically and internationally. The President works closely with the NBA Commissioner and other executives to ensure the league runs smoothly and maintains its reputation. Additionally, the NBA President often represents the league in negotiations, media appearances, and public events.

What are the main challenges an NBA President faces when managing league operations and team relations?

An NBA President regularly navigates complex challenges such as balancing the interests of team owners, players, and stakeholders while ensuring the league's growth and integrity. The role involves addressing collective bargaining agreements, overseeing disciplinary actions, and managing relationships with media partners. Additionally, the President must stay ahead of industry trends, promote global expansion, and respond proactively to evolving fan expectations, making strong leadership and negotiation skills essential.

WHAT WE DO Playfly Sports is the full-service, leading sports marketing and media company that enables brands to engage with sports fans on a local, regional, and national level through scaled linear, digital, and experiential assets. Playfly Sports drives outcome-based solutions into 90-million households via more than 7,800 live U.S. broadcasts of MLB, NBA, and NHL games; and influences sports fans of all ages through the management of college and high school multimedia rights, uniform branding, and high-profile sports sponsorship platforms.
